Recipe View 5 mins Preheat the o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C). Grease a baking sheet. (5 minutes)

Image Step 02
02 Step

Recipe View 10 mins Stir flour and salt together in a large bowl. Rub in butter until m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Make a well in the center; pour in milk and water, then stir until dough comes together. (10 minutes)

Image Step 03
03 Step

Recipe View 5 mins Turn dough out onto a lightly floured surface and form into an 8-inch-diameter round loaf. Place loaf onto the prepared pan; cut a cross in the top using a sharp knife. (5 minutes)

Image Step 04
04 Step

Recipe View 35 mins Bake in the preheated oven for 25 minutes; lower the temperature to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C) and continue to bake for an additional 5 to 10 minutes. The loaf should be golden brown and the bottom should sound hollow when tapped. (35 minutes)

For a richer flavor, try using buttermilk instead of regular milk.
If you don't have self-rising flour, you can make your own by adding 1 1/2 teaspoons of baking powder and 1/2 teaspoon of salt per cup of all-purpose flour.
Serve warm with butter, jam, or golden syrup for an authentic Australian experience.
